Solution Overview

Problem

The existing process of validating and settling paper coupons is slow, labor-intensive, and prone to fraud, requiring manual counting and validation, which can lead to disputes and delayed reimbursement for retailers.

Innovation Solution

A real-time network-based system, the Intelligent Clearing Network (ICN), which uses POS terminals to read GS1 barcode data, transmit coupon information over a network for validation and redemption, and facilitates financial settlement through an ICN server and database, eliminating the need for manual counting and reducing fraud.

AI summary

A system for validating, redeeming, and financially settling coupons is described. The system includes a real time network through which a Point-of-Sale (POS) device communicates with an Intelligent Clearing Network (ICN) server. The ICN server is configured to run a real time application while in communication with the POS device, wherein the POS device transmits coupon data elements read at the POS device and other consumer transaction information including universal product codes purchased, and transaction details to the ICN server via the network. The ICN server validates the coupon data elements and provides the POS device information in order to redeem coupons. Apparatus and computer readable media are also described.
